The Importance of Prompt Reporting: What to Do After a Slip and Fall

Slip and fall accidents can happen unexpectedly, leaving individuals injured and potentially facing long-term consequences. In the aftermath of such incidents, taking prompt and appropriate action is crucial. Reporting the incident promptly not only ensures your safety but also plays a significant role in the legal and insurance processes that may follow. In this blog, we’ll delve into the importance of prompt reporting and outline the necessary steps to take after a slip and fall.

1. Prioritize Your Safety:

The immediate aftermath of a slip and fall can be disorienting, but it’s vital to prioritize your safety. Assess yourself for injuries and seek medical attention if necessary. If you are unable to move or are in severe pain, call for help or ask someone nearby to assist you.

2. Identify the Cause:

Take note of the conditions that led to the slip and fall. Was it a wet floor, uneven surface, or a hidden obstacle? Documenting the cause of the accident is essential for both your safety and any potential legal actions that may follow.

3. Report the Incident:

Notify the property owner, manager, or relevant authority about the slip and fall incident as soon as possible. Provide them with a clear and factual account of what happened. Be sure to obtain the contact information of the person to whom you report the incident.

4. Document the Scene:

If possible, take photographs of the scene, focusing on the hazardous conditions that caused your fall. These visual records can serve as valuable evidence later on. Additionally, note the date, time, and any relevant details that might help in recreating the circumstances surrounding the incident.

5. Gather Witness Information:

If there were witnesses to your slip and fall, obtain their contact information. Witness testimonies can be crucial in establishing the facts of the accident and supporting your case if legal action becomes necessary.

6. Seek Medical Attention:

Even if your injuries seem minor initially, it’s advisable to seek medical attention promptly. Some injuries may not manifest symptoms immediately, and a medical professional can assess the extent of your injuries and provide documentation for your case.

7. Preserve Evidence:

Preserve any evidence related to the incident, such as the clothes you were wearing at the time or the shoes that may have contributed to the slip and fall. This evidence can help establish the circumstances and conditions surrounding the accident.

8. Consult with an Attorney:

If you believe that negligence played a role in your slip and fall, it’s wise to consult with a personal injury attorney. They can provide guidance on the legal aspects of your case and help you navigate the process of seeking compensation for your injuries.

Mitigating Slip and Fall Injuries During Winter: A Guide to Avoiding Cold Weather Hazards

This article aims to provide valuable insights and recommendations on preventing slip and fall injuries during the winter season.

By understanding and effectively addressing the hazards associated with cold weather conditions, individuals can significantly reduce the risk of accidents and injuries.

Read on to discover practical strategies for navigating winter hazards and ensuring personal safety.

1. Maintaining Proper Footwear: One of the key factors in preventing slip and fall incidents during the winter is wearing appropriately. During the winter season, when the world is covered in a layer of frost, the aesthetically pleasing landscapes pose an underlying threat: a heightened susceptibility to slip and fall injuries. The presence of icy sidewalks, snow-covered driveways, and freezing temperatures gives rise to hazardous circumstances that have the potential to result in accidents. This blog post aims to examine the prevalent winter hazards that contribute to slip and fall injuries and offer crucial guidance on safely navigating the cold weather.
2. Utilize Suitable Footwear: The selection of appropriate footwear plays a crucial role in mitigating the risk of slips and falls during the winter. It is recommended to select footwear, such as shoes or boots, that are equipped with slip-resistant soles in order to enhance traction on surfaces that are icy. It is recommended to utilize ice cleats or traction devices in order to enhance stability.
3. Walkway Maintenance: In order to prevent the accumulation of snow and ice, it is important to regularly shovel snow and remove ice from walkways, driveways, and entrances. The application of rock salt or ice melt can be beneficial for melting ice and creating a safer walking surface. It is important to remove snow from your vehicle to prevent slipping hazards when entering or exiting the car.
4. Employ a Methodical Approach: When traversing icy or snow-covered surfaces, it is recommended to take small, intentional steps. This feature aids in the preservation of one’s balance and serves to mitigate the potential hazard of slipping. It is advisable to refrain from hastening and allocate additional time for the purpose of arriving at your intended location.
5. Handrails should be utilized to enhance support and stability, particularly when traversing stairs or inclines. It is recommended to consistently utilize handrails whenever they are accessible and exercise caution while navigating outdoor staircases in winter conditions.
6. It is important to remain vigilant and aware of the constantly shifting conditions that can occur during winter weather. It is important to remain updated on weather forecasts and maintain vigilance regarding any alterations in conditions while walking outdoors. It is advisable to refrain from traversing areas that exhibit signs of being slippery or posing a potential danger.
7. Opt for Well-Illuminated Pathways: During the winter season, characterized by reduced daylight, maintaining visibility can pose a significant challenge. It is advisable to select well-illuminated pathways when traversing outdoor areas. In the event that adequate lighting is not available, it is recommended to carry a flashlight for enhanced visibility and safety. The utilization of illuminated paths aids in the identification of potential hazards and facilitates safe navigation.
8. Black Ice Awareness: Black ice, which refers to a thin layer of ice that is difficult to detect visually, poses a frequent risk during winter seasons. Exercise caution when approaching shaded areas, bridges, and overpasses due to their increased susceptibility to the formation of black ice. It is advisable to consider the possibility of ice formation when encountering wet or dark-colored pavement.
9. Maintaining Hands-Free: The act of carrying heavy bags or items can have an adverse impact on your balance, thereby increasing your vulnerability to slips and falls. It is advisable to maintain hands-free mobility whenever feasible by utilizing a backpack or other suitable hands-free carrying alternatives.
10. Select Indoor Routes: Whenever possible, it is advisable to choose indoor routes or pathways that are covered. By minimizing exposure to outdoor winter hazards, the risk of slipping and falling is reduced.
11. Emergency Preparedness: Even with the implementation of preventive measures, unforeseen incidents may still occur. It is advisable to ensure that you have a fully charged mobile phone readily available in the event of emergencies. Additionally, it is recommended to inform a trusted individual about your travel itinerary when encountering icy conditions.

Who is eligible to file a wrongful death lawsuit; Gaining a comprehensive grasp of the legal framework

Family members or dependents may have the right to seek redress and compensation by filing a wrongful death lawsuit if another person’s negligence or wrongful actions were the cause of the deceased person’s death. Nevertheless, the regulations regarding who is eligible to file a wrongful death claim differ from jurisdiction to jurisdiction. As part of this article, we look into the legal framework that determines who can file a wrongful death lawsuit. This includes a detailed look at the laws that make someone eligible.

Understanding Wrongful Death Lawsuits:

A wrongful death lawsuit is a legal recourse taken against an individual or entity responsible for causing the untimely demise of another person due to their careless or deliberate actions. These lawsuits have two main objectives:
Compensation: Wrongful death claims seek to provide financial support to the loved ones left behind after a tragic loss, helping them cope with the various hardships caused by the untimely passing.
They ensure that the responsible party is held accountable for their actions, prioritizing safety and working towards preventing similar incidents in the future.

Who is eligible to file a wrongful death lawsuit?

The laws of the jurisdiction where the incident occurred determine who is qualified to file a wrongful death lawsuit. However, there are several common categories of eligible claimants:
In most jurisdictions, spouses, children, and parents are usually considered the primary eligible claimants when it comes to immediate family members. These individuals typically have the closest emotional and financial connections to the deceased.

Dependents and Financial Beneficiaries:

Besides immediate family members, dependents who depended on the deceased individual for financial support might qualify to file a wrongful death claim. This category may encompass individuals such as domestic partners, stepchildren, or those who can provide evidence of their financial dependence on the deceased.

In certain situations, it may be possible for a personal representative of the deceased person’s estate to file a wrongful death claim. The compensation obtained in these cases is typically allocated to the heirs or beneficiaries of the deceased individual as a component of the estate.
In certain jurisdictions, distant relatives like cousins or siblings may have the opportunity to file a wrongful death lawsuit if there are no immediate family members present.
Legal guardians or adopted children may have the opportunity to file a wrongful death claim, depending on the laws of the jurisdiction.
In certain states, parents who have lost an unborn child may be able to file a wrongful death claim, especially if the child was viable outside the womb. This legal route enables recognition and potential compensation for the devastating loss these parents have suffered.

Differences in Legal Systems Across Jurisdictions:

It’s worth mentioning that wrongful death laws differ depending on the jurisdiction. Every state or country has its own unique set of rules and regulations that dictate the eligibility criteria for filing a wrongful death lawsuit, as well as the specific types and amounts of compensation that can be sought. These laws may also outline the timeframe in which a wrongful death claim must be filed.

Important Information about Slip and Fall Injuries in Grocery Stores

Going to the grocery store is just another part of our everyday lives. However, even the most mundane task can quickly become a chaotic experience when slip-and-fall accidents come into play. Such incidents are quite frequent in grocery stores and can result in injuries ranging from minor bruises to more serious harm. Discover the underlying factors behind slip and fall accidents in grocery stores and gain valuable insights on how to effectively address them.

The Slippery Situation of the Grocery Store Environment

Grocery stores can be quite bustling, with numerous factors that may contribute to slip-and-fall accidents. There are several factors that can contribute to this issue:
Spills are a common culprit behind slip-and-fall accidents in grocery stores. These can range from various liquids like water and milk to cleaning solutions or even shattered bottles.
Grocery stores frequently have wet or damp floors near the entrance, particularly when the weather is bad. Be cautious in these wet areas to avoid any potential accidents.
The fresh produce sections are a vital component of every grocery store. Nevertheless, these areas frequently have wet or damp floors due to misting systems, and fallen fruits and vegetables can pose tripping hazards.
Insufficient Signage: Neglecting to display proper caution signs when floors are wet or being cleaned can result in unfortunate accidents.
Watch out for damaged aisles. Uneven flooring, carpets, and protruding objects can be hazardous and lead to accidents.
After experiencing a slip-and-fall incident, it’s crucial to know what steps to take next. Handling the situation properly can make a significant difference in your ability to seek compensation for any injuries or damages. Here are the essential actions you should consider following a slip and fall:
If you’ve had the unfortunate experience of a slip and fall incident in a grocery store, it’s absolutely essential to be aware of the necessary actions to be taken:
Get Medical Help: If you’ve been injured, it’s crucial to seek immediate medical attention. It’s important to remember that certain injuries may not show symptoms immediately, even if you don’t feel significantly injured.
Please provide details about the incident. Please notify the store manager or an employee regarding the incident. It is essential to include the incident in their report.
Gather evidence: If feasible, capture photographs of the location where the incident took place. These can be invaluable evidence for future reference.
Collect contact information from any witnesses to the accident, if there were any. Statements may be required at a later time.
Protect Your Garments: Retain the clothing you had on during the incident as proof in case it becomes soiled or harmed.
Seek Legal Advice: If you’re contemplating legal action, it’s advisable to seek guidance from a personal injury attorney who specializes in slip and fall cases. They have the expertise to assess the validity of your claim and provide expert guidance throughout the process.
Seeking Compensation: Exploring Your Legal Options
Under certain circumstances, grocery stores may bear responsibility for slip and fall incidents. If the store’s negligence, such as not promptly cleaning up spills or providing proper warning signs, contributed to the accident, you could potentially receive comp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and the pain and suffering you’ve endured.

Exploring Cases That Lead to Tragic Scenarios for Common Causes of Wrongful Death

Legal situations known as “wrongful death” occur when someone loses their life as a result of the carelessness or malice of another party. These cases cover a wide spectrum of situations, but several factors stand out as the most typical causes. In this essay, we examine the typical wrongful death causes in order to shed light on the circumstances behind these terrible occurrences.
1. Medical Malpractice:
Medical malpractice is one of the most prevalent causes of wrongful death. It encompasses a wide range of situations where healthcare professionals fail to meet the standard of care, resulting in patient harm or death. Common instances of medical malpractice leading to wrongful death include:
Surgical errors
Medication errors
Misdiagnosis or delayed diagnosis
Anesthesia errors
Birth injuries
Neglect or inadequate care in hospitals or nursing homes
2. Car Accidents:
Fatal car accidents claim thousands of lives each year. Wrongful death cases stemming from car accidents often involve:
Reckless or impaired driving
Speeding
Distracted driving (e.g., texting)
Failure to obey traffic laws
Poor road conditions
Defective vehicle components
3. Workplace Accidents:
Wrongful deaths in the workplace are tragic and, in many cases, preventable. These incidents typically occur in industries with inherent risks, such as construction or manufacturing. Common causes include:
Falls from heights
Electrocutions
Equipment malfunctions
Failure to provide safety equipment
Lack of proper training
Hazardous material exposure
4. Product Liability:
Defective products can lead to catastrophic injuries and, in some instances, wrongful death. Product liability cases may involve:
Defective automobiles
Unsafe medical devices
Toxic or contaminated food products
Faulty industrial equipment
Dangerous pharmaceuticals
5. Nursing Home Neglect and Abuse:
Elderly residents in nursing homes are vulnerable to neglect and abuse, often resulting in wrongful death. Common issues in nursing homes include:
Malnutrition or dehydration
Falls and fractures
Bedsores
Medication errors
Physical or emotional abuse
Poor infection control
6. Criminal Acts:
In some cases, wrongful death occurs due to criminal acts, such as homicide or manslaughter. These cases often lead to criminal trials alongside civil wrongful death actions. Common criminal acts leading to wrongful death include:
Assault
Domestic violence
Drunk driving
Murder or manslaughter
7. Recreational and Sporting Accidents:
Recreational and sporting activities carry inherent risks, and tragic accidents can happen. Common scenarios include:
Drownings in swimming pools or natural bodies of water
Traumatic brain injuries in contact sports
Accidents during extreme sports or adventure activities
8. Aviation Accidents:
Although relatively rare, aviation accidents can lead to multiple wrongful death cases. These may result from:
Pilot error
Mechanical failures
Air traffic control errors
Weather-related issues

Seeking Justice:

In the aftermath of a wrongful death, families often seek justice and compensation for their loss. Legal action may involve filing a wrongful death lawsuit to hold responsible parties accountable and seek damages, which can include medical expenses, funeral costs, lost income, and pain and suffering.
